Description

Are you passionate about ensuring the quality and safety of products? Kelly Science is seeking a meticulous and detail-oriented Associate Quality Control Analyst to join our team. In this role, you will play a crucial part in supporting operations by performing analytical tests independently and accurately, adhering to strict guidelines and timelines.
Full-time
Pay: $22/hr
3rd Shift


Exposure to techniques such as HPLC or GC is preferred, with a preference for candidates with a background in chemistry.

Responsibilities:

  • Independently perform analytical tests as outlined in test procedures, ensuring precision and adherence to protocols.
  • Gather and test samples promptly within the expected timeframe, and store them appropriately to maintain integrity.
  • Collect samples of incoming supplies, in-process samples, and finished products, contributing to the thorough evaluation of product quality.
  • Execute non-routine procedures with minimal supervision, demonstrating adaptability and problem-solving skills.
  • Maintain meticulous and accurate records of all tests conducted, following company policies and record-keeping procedures to ensure traceability and compliance.
  • Adhere strictly to safety and quality guidelines, including Good Laboratory Practices and lab safety requirements, to uphold standards of excellence.
  • Maintain a clean and safe work environment, contributing to a culture of safety and professionalism.
  • Provide support to laboratory management by maintaining a communication log and transferring information to facilitate seamless operations and meet customer requirements.
  • Assist in maintaining the validated state of the lab, contributing to the continuous improvement and reliability of laboratory processes.
  • Aid in the maintenance of equipment, including routine maintenance and troubleshooting of common or simple problems with instruments, ensuring smooth operations.
  • Collaborate effectively as part of a technical group in a multi-cultural and diverse work environment, working towards shared goals and objectives.
